温馨提示×

PHP中assert函数的跨平台兼容性分析

PHP
小樊
82
2024-08-12 06:26:34
栏目: 编程语言

在PHP中,assert函数用于断言一个表达式为真。它的用法类似于其他编程语言中的断言函数,用于在代码中检查条件是否满足,如果条件不满足则触发一个错误。

在不同的PHP版本中,assert函数的行为可能会有所不同。在PHP 7.0之前的版本中,assert函数默认是关闭的,需要通过设置assert.active配置选项为1来启用。而在PHP 7.0及以上的版本中,assert函数默认是开启的。

另外,assert函数在不同的操作系统上也可能会有一些差异。一般来说,assert函数在各个主流操作系统上都能正常工作,但在一些特殊的环境下可能会出现兼容性问题。因此,在编写跨平台的PHP代码时,建议在使用assert函数时避免依赖特定于操作系统的行为。

总的来说,PHP中的assert函数在大多数情况下都具有良好的跨平台兼容性,但在一些特殊情况下可能会存在一些差异。因此,在编写代码时建议注意这些差异,以确保代码在不同平台上都能正常运行。

0